FARM FOR SHELL-SHOCK SOLDIERS

MASTERTON A. AND P. ASSOCIATION'S EFFORT. (B.v Telegranh— Stecial CorrcßDondenO Masterton, September 17. The eub-ccminitteo set up by the Masterton A. and P. Association to endeavour to procure a farm for occupation by shell-shock soldiers has been ?.o far -successful that an area of about 700 f.crcs lias been made aavilable. I'ull details wi'.l be made known later.
